Output 2ec35424bef440ef2b879fbbdd5527968d12f0a4e071fc7b9aad66e2a8009516:2

value
138383
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98787d8c71011314962dd9af561325b6df6acde2 OP_EQUALVERIFY OP_CHECKSIG
address
1EuC3ypbdgWVSayGQgUt8xyi78WfSsw5r3
transaction
2ec35424bef440ef2b879fbbdd5527968d12f0a4e071fc7b9aad66e2a8009516
spent
true